SAN MATEO, Calif. and CAMBRIDGE, Mass., Aug. 08, 2023 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Kronos Bio, Inc. (Nasdaq: KRON), a company dedicated to transforming the lives of those affected by cancer, today reported recent business progress and second-quarter 2023 financial results.
“KB-0742 is the first molecule to emerge from our discovery platform and we are looking forward to presenting data from the Phase 1 dose escalation portion of the Phase 1/2 KB-0742 study at the upcoming AACR-NCI-EORTC International Conference,” said Norbert Bischofberger, Ph.D., president and chief executive officer of Kronos Bio. “We’ve observed target engagement and have opened expansion cohorts at the 60 milligram dose. Simultaneously, we are further dose escalating to identify the maximum tolerated dose. Strong investigator engagement and patient enrollment in our KB-0742 and lanraplenib clinical programs reinforce the significant unmet need for new and innovative therapies for these difficult-to-treat cancers.”
Bischofberger continued, “Our lanraplenib program recently progressed onto the third dosing cohort at 60 milligrams, and we are on track to reach our recommended Phase 2 dose by year end or early 2024. In addition, as a result of strong investigator interest, we will be allowing additional patients to enroll at dose levels that have previously been cleared. We look forward to sharing data from the escalation cohorts in mid-2024.”

About Kronos Bio, Inc.
Kronos Bio is a biopharmaceutical company that is advancing two investigational compounds in clinical trials for patients with cancer. The company is developing the CDK9 inhibitor KB-0742 as a treatment for MYC-amplified solid tumors and other transcriptionally addicted solid tumors and lanraplenib, a next-generation SYK inhibitor, for patients with FLT3-mutated acute myeloid leukemia. The company’s scientific focus is on developing medicines that target the deregulated transcription that is the hallmark of cancer and other serious diseases.
